Transaction 65b5898077b06aa27d869685619daeb66a6278bd8af3402dc667c94362aa2ffe
1 Input
1 Output
-
65b5898077b06aa27d869685619daeb66a6278bd8af3402dc667c94362aa2ffe:0
- value
- 178886
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f846f3acdd9afb63131be7edc93604f60298a665 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PdmaPvywHakUn8BLAg3yBfJkzG53ejeUn